[PATCH] staging: hv: storvsc: ignore SET_WINDOW scsi command

Olaf Hering olaf at aepfle.de
Mon Oct 10 07:37:39 UTC 2011


Some commands sent by smartd will offline the device.
With this change applied, smartd sill not monitor the device anymore.

+static bool storvsc_check_scsi_cmd(struct scsi_cmnd *scmnd)
+{
+	bool allowed = true;
+	u8 scsi_op = scmnd->cmnd[0];
+
+	switch (scsi_op) {
+		/* smartd sends this command, which will offline the device */
+		case SET_WINDOW:
+			scmnd->result = DID_ERROR << 16;
+			allowed = false;
+			break;
+		default:
+			break;
+	}
+	return allowed;
+}
